Embedded Cross Trigger (ECT) System
The ECT system provides a mechanism for HPS modules to trigger each other. The ECT consists of the
following modules:
• Cross Trigger Interface (CTI)
• Cross Trigger Matrix (CTM)
Figure 7-2: Generic ECT System
The following figure shows how CTIs and CTMs are used in a generic ECT setup. The red line depicts an
trigger input to one CTI generating a trigger output in another CTI. Though the signal travels throughout
channel 2, it only enters and exits through trigger inputs and outputs you configure.
